Our next adventure with Link was once promised to arrive in 2015, but Nintendo has announced a second delay meaning that The Legend of Zelda won’t see release until 2017.

Said to be the company’s only playable game at their E3 2016 booth, it has now been confirmed that Wii U and NX versions have been developed “in tandem.”

“The latest instalment in this classic series is scheduled to launch simultaneously for both Wii U and NX, and both versions of the game have been in development in tandem,” Nintendo has today shared. “Because developers need more time to polish the game, it will launch in 2017, but it will be the focus of Nintendo’s presence at E3.”

First shown at E3 2014, it is remarkable how little is known about what our next trek across Hyrule will involve. We had chance to take a second look at The Game Awards 2014, but haven’t heard much more about the iteration since.
